What is Family Therapy?
Family therapy, also known as family counseling, is a specialized form of therapy that focuses on improving communication and resolving conflicts within the entire family unit. It's not just about addressing individual issues; it aims to strengthen the bonds between family members and create a more harmonious family dynamic.
The Role of Licensed Therapists
Licensed therapists who specialize in family therapy play a crucial role in guiding families through the therapeutic process. They are trained to identify unhealthy patterns, facilitate open and productive communication, and help families navigate major life transitions and challenges.

The Therapeutic Process in Family Therapy Chicago
The Initial Assessment
The therapeutic process typically begins with an initial assessment where the family meets with the therapist. This is an opportunity to discuss the family's concerns and goals for therapy.
Setting Therapeutic Goals
During the initial assessment, the therapist and the family collaborate to set therapeutic goals. These goals guide the course of therapy and provide a clear sense of direction.
Family Therapy Sessions
Regular family therapy sessions follow the initial assessment. These sessions are a safe and supportive environment for family members to express their thoughts and feelings, learn effective communication skills, and work towards resolution.
Individual Therapy Within Family Therapy
In some cases, individual family members may benefit from individual therapy sessions in addition to family therapy. This can address specific individual issues while still contributing to the overall progress of the family unit.
Conflict Resolution and Communication Skills
Family therapy often involves conflict resolution techniques and communication skill-building exercises. These tools help families navigate tough times and develop healthier ways of interacting.
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and More
Various therapeutic approaches may be used within family therapy, including c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) to address behavioral issues and concerns of identity. The therapist tailors the approach to the unique needs of the family.
